    Professional Background

    Nathan Bakken is a dedicated professional in the transit industry, currently working as a Transit Information Representative at Metro Transit in Minnesota. With a passion for urban studies and a commitment to enhancing public transportation systems, Nathan has cultivated a robust career focused on improving transit accessibility and efficiency. His expertise in transit operations is reflected in his previous positions, including a Transit Control Center Operations Intern and Light Rail Ambassador Intern at Metro Transit. Through these roles, Nathan has developed a comprehensive understanding of operational logistics and customer service within the public transit framework.

    Education and Achievements

    Nathan’s academic journey began at East Grand Forks Senior High School, where he completed his high school education. He furthered his academic pursuits by earning a Bachelor’s Degree in Urban Studies and Planning from the prestigious University of Minnesota-Twin Cities. This foundational education equipped him with the knowledge and analytical skills necessary to address the complexities of urban transportation systems and to contribute meaningfully to community planning and development.

    Career Progression

    Nathan's early career included several customer service and sales roles, where he honed his ability to communicate effectively and collaborate with diverse groups of people. His time as a Sales Supervisor at Lacoste and a Supervisor/Key Holder at Sperry allowed him to develop strong leadership skills and a detailed understanding of retail operations. Eventually, he transitioned into the transit sector by joining Metro Transit, where his passion for urban transport systems could come to life.

    At Metro Transit, Nathan has taken on various challenging positions that have prepared him for success in the industry. As a Transit Control Center Operations Intern, he gained valuable hands-on experience in managing transit operations while learning about the intricacies of service delivery. As an intern, he was not only able to apply his academic knowledge but also observe firsthand how efficient transit systems operate on a day-to-day basis.

    As a current Transit Information Representative, Nathan plays a vital role in assisting transit riders and promoting the use of public transportation. His skills allow him to effectively communicate important transit information, contribute to the planning of user-friendly services, and provide insight into the continuous improvement of transit options available to the community.
